mobile theme mode icon
theme mode light icon theme mode dark icon
Random Question Willekeurig
speech play
speech pause
speech stop

Wat is canonicalisatie in webontwikkeling?

Canonicalisatie is het proces waarbij een URL naar de standaardvorm wordt geconverteerd, waardoor het eenvoudiger wordt URL's te vergelijken en te beheren. Hierbij wordt alle onnodige informatie uit de URL verwijderd, zoals queryparameters en fragment-ID's, en deze vervangen door een enkele schuine streep aan het einde van de URL. Dit helpt ervoor te zorgen dat alle URL's dezelfde indeling hebben en gemakkelijk kunnen worden vergeleken en beheerd.

De volgende twee URL's zijn bijvoorbeeld gelijkwaardig en kunnen worden gecanonicaliseerd naar:

* http://example.com/products?sort=price&limit =10
* http://example.com/products?sort=price&limit=10#reviews

Beide URL's hebben dezelfde informatie, maar de tweede URL heeft een fragment-ID (#reviews) die niet nodig is om de URL goed te laten functioneren . Door deze fragment-ID te verwijderen en een enkele schuine streep aan het einde van de URL toe te voegen, kunnen we deze canonicaliseren naar:

* http://example.com/products?sort=price&limit=10/

Deze gestandaardiseerde vorm van de URL maakt het eenvoudiger om URL's te vergelijken en te beheren, en om de prestaties van webapplicaties te verbeteren door het aantal verzoeken aan de server te verminderen.

Knowway.org gebruikt cookies om u beter van dienst te kunnen zijn. Door Knowway.org te gebruiken, gaat u akkoord met ons gebruik van cookies. Voor gedetailleerde informatie kunt u ons Cookiebeleid lezen. close-policy